Intensive Winning Grants Seminar
A Seminar for volunteers, staff and fundraisers on how to win the MOST GRANTS EVER for your community organisation
This course provides the answer to all your grantseeking questions. Learn the secrets for easily winning more grants for your community organisation, and find out how to drastically increase the number of grants you can apply for without pushing yourself (and your group) into an early grave.
You Will Learn:
- The best ways to present your proposal - tell the story of your project and your group to the greatest advantage
- How to develop your statement of need - choosing data to support your project proposal
- How to develop an "organisation template" - to save time in writing applications
- How to humanise your story - presenting a compelling picture
- How to navigate the grants landscape - sorting out which grants are best for your project
- How to write a proposal - every word matters; style, treatment and content
- Making friends and long-term relationships with grantmakers - managing relationships, acknowledging funders
- Giving the grantmaker what they want - how to tailor your proposal for multiple grantmakers
- Creating winning project plans & realistic budgets - ensure project plans and budgets get the proposal across the line
- Meeting different requirements from different sources - different levels of government, philanthropic and corporate
